What is a web developer government?

A Web Developer in government is responsible for designing, developing, and maintaining websites and web applications for public sector organizations. They ensure websites are accessible, secure, and user-friendly while complying with government regulations and standards. Their work may involve front-end and back-end development, content management systems, and integrating databases or APIs. Government web developers often collaborate with designers, cybersecurity teams, and policymakers to provide digital services to citizens efficiently.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the web developer government position, and why are they important?

A Web Developer Government role requires strong proficiency in HTML, CSS, JavaScript, web accessibility standards, and relevant government regulations, often backed by a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with content management systems (such as Drupal or WordPress), secure coding practices, and federal or state-level compliance certifications (like Section 508 accessibility) is also critical. Attention to detail, strong problem-solving skills, and effective communication are essential soft skills for excelling in this environment. These skills ensure that web applications are secure, accessible, and meet the stringent requirements unique to public sector organizations.

What are some typical challenges faced by web developers working in a government environment?

Web developers in government settings often encounter strict regulations around accessibility, security, and data privacy, which means ensuring all websites meet rigorous federal or state standards. You may also work with legacy systems and constrained budgets, which can require creative problem-solving and adaptability. Collaboration across departments and responding to the needs of diverse stakeholders is common, so clear communication is essential. Despite these challenges, many developers find fulfillment in contributing to public-facing services that have a tangible impact on citizens.

Description

We are seeking a Data Operations Engineer to design, build, and maintain real-time and near-realtime data ingestion pipelines supporting a mission-critical system and moves data across security domains using cross domain solutions (CDS) / guards. You will be responsible for the reliable flow of streaming data from a wide range of sources into our data platform, ensuring data quality, observability, and scalability.

You'll partner closely with data engineers, platform engineers, analytics teams, and security/governance personnel to deliver trustworthy, low-latency data that supports operational decisions — while ensuring compliance with cross-domain and data classification requirements. This position is on-site in Honolulu, HI.

Key Responsibilities

  • Aid the team in delivering continual data feeds to users and monitoring the health of data quality and overall data ingest.
  • Design, build, and maintain resilient real-time/near-realtime ingestion pipelines using Apache NiFi and REST APIs, with appropriate backpressure, prioritization, retries, and error-handling strategies.
  • Configure and monitor data flows moving across security domains via cross domain guards/solutions, ensuring data integrity and compliance with transfer policies.
  • Parse, transform, validate, and route structured and unstructured data in a variety of formats, including Excel, CSV, JSON, and XML.
  • Employ data manipulation and visualization tools (e.g., Grafana, Prometheus) to effectively convey pipeline status, data quality, and historical trends to leadership, users, and the data team.
  • Collaborate with platform, software, and other data engineers to (re)configure and continuously improve data ingestion pipeline reliability.
  • Develop and maintain software/scripts to automate monitoring of real-time feeds and alert on timeliness, volume, lineage, and distribution data issues.
  • Translate learnings from historical pipeline data into actionable steps to improve data ingest reliability and performance.
  • Partner with security and governance teams to enforce encryption, authentication, authorization, and data classification requirements across pipelines and cross-domain transfers.
  • Write and maintain scripts (Python, Bash, or similar) to automate data processing, validation, and monitoring tasks.
  • Document data flows, system configurations, and standard operating procedures.
